Lamesa is located in Texas. Lamesa, Texas has a population of 8,685. Lamesa is less family-centric than the surrounding county with 29.46%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 32.17%.
The median household income in Lamesa, Texas is $36,351. The median household income for the surrounding county is $42,778 compared to the national median of $69,021. The median age of people living in Lamesa is 34.4 years.
The average high temperature in July is 93.1 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 27.9 degrees. The average rainfall is approximately 19.2 inches per year, with 4.4 inches of snow per year.
